Realistic Failure Modes
Operators experience every failure mode they could encounter on a real apparatus: cavitation from low intake pressure, hose bursts from over-pressure, pump overheating from closed recirculation, and tank depletion from poor water management.
Pump Curve Behavior
The simulator models realistic pump performance. As flow increases, available pressure decreases according to the pump's rated capacity. Operators learn to work within the pump's actual performance envelope.
Multiple Supply Types
Hydrant supply with residual pressure, tank water with declining level, draft operations with primer and vacuum, and relay pumping with intake boost. Each supply type behaves differently and requires different operator techniques.
Real-Time Gauge Response
Gauges respond to operator inputs the way a real pump panel does. Throttle changes don't produce instant pressure jumps — operators learn the feel of a real panel where changes take time to stabilise.
